The crystal structure of the newly discovered compound UTiBi
was determined from single-crystal X-ray diffraction data. This compound shows an antiferromagnetic ordering at 31.5 K. A clear anomaly was observed at the transition temperature on the temperature dependence of magnetic susceptibility and electrical resistivity.

被引用回数:2 パーセンタイル:19.53(Physics, Multidisciplinary)A heavy Fermion compound UBe shows superconductivity below 0.9 K. Earlier study detected an anomaly at 0.7 K deep within the superconducting phase, which was attributed to an additional magnetic phase transition. In this paper, Josephson effect and point-contact spectroscopy have been used to investigate the anomaly in detail. The increase of the Josephson critical current and a continuous drop of the zero-bias conductivity below 0.7 K strongly suggest an enhancement of superconducting order parameter rather than magnetic effects.
